Casearia guianensis: Guyanese Wild Coffee

Casearia guianensis, commonly known as Guyanese wild coffee, is a plant species found in Guyana and other parts of Latin America.

Taxonomy and Nomenclature

  • Scientific Name: Casearia guianensis (Aubl.) Urb.
  • Common Name: Guyanese wild coffee
  • Kingdom: Plantae
  • Family: Salicaceae (formerly Flacourtiaceae)
  • Taxonomic Rank: Species (also referred to as a subspecies)
  • Synonym: Iroucana guianensis Aubl.

Distribution and Habitat

  • Casearia guianensis is native to Guyana and possibly other areas of Latin America.

Uses

  • Macerated leaves are reportedly used as an antipruritic (anti-itch treatment) in Guyana.
  • In Guyana, it has been reported that it is mixed with coffee.

Additional Common Names (Guyana)

  • hubudi
  • merehi
  • ubudi
  • wild cashew
